The Zed Attack Proxy (ZAP) is an easy to use integrated penetration testing tool for finding vulnerabilities in web applications. It is designed to be used by people with a wide range of security experience and as such is ideal for developers and functional testers who are new to penetration testing. ZAP provides automated scanners as well as a set of tools that allow you to find security vulnerabilities manually.

package ch.csnc.extension.httpclient;

import java.io.ByteArrayInputStream;
import java.io.InputStream;
import java.nio.charset.StandardCharsets;
import org.apache.commons.lang.StringUtils;

/**
 * A representation of PKCS#11 provider configuration. Used to create configurations for instances
 * of {@code sun.security.pkcs11.SunPKCS11} and {@code
 * com.ibm.crypto.pkcs11impl.provider.IBMPKCS11Impl}.
 *
 * 

Example usage: * *

* *
 * PKCS11Configuration configuration = PKCS11Configuration.builder()
 *         .setName("Provider X")
 *         .setLibrary("/path/to/pkcs11library")
 *         .setSlotId(1)
 *         .build();
 *
 * java.security.Provider p = new sun.security.pkcs11.SunPKCS11(new ByteArrayInputStream(configuration.toString().getBytes()));
 * java.security.Security.addProvider(p);
 * 
* *
* *

Note: Only the mandatory attributes, name and library, and the * optional attributes, description, slot and slotListIndex are implemented. * * @see Sun * PKCS#11 Configuration * @see IBM * PKCS#11 Configuration */ public class PKCS11Configuration { private final String name; private final String library; private final String description; private final int slotId; private final int slotListIndex; private PKCS11Configuration( String name, String library, String description, int slotId, int slotListIndex) { super(); this.name = name; this.library = library; this.description = description; this.slotId = slotId; this.slotListIndex = slotListIndex; } public String getName() { return name; } public String getLibrary() { return library; } public String getDescription() { return description; } public int getSlotListIndex() { return slotListIndex; } public int getSlotId() { return slotId; } @Override public String toString() { StringBuilder sbConfiguration = new StringBuilder(150); sbConfiguration .append("name = \"") .append(escapeBackslashesAndQuotationMarks(name)) .append("\"\n"); sbConfiguration.append("library = ").append(library).append('\n'); if (description != null && !description.isEmpty()) { sbConfiguration.append("description = ").append(description).append('\n'); } if (slotListIndex != -1) { sbConfiguration.append("slotListIndex = ").append(slotListIndex); } else { sbConfiguration.append("slot = ").append(slotId); } sbConfiguration.append('\n'); return sbConfiguration.toString(); } private static String escapeBackslashesAndQuotationMarks(String value) { String[] searchValues = new String[] {"\\", "\""}; String[] replacementValues = new String[] {"\\\\", "\\\""}; return StringUtils.replaceEach(value, searchValues, replacementValues); } public InputStream toInpuStream() { return new ByteArrayInputStream(toString().getBytes(StandardCharsets.UTF_8)); } public static PCKS11ConfigurationBuilder builder() { return new PCKS11ConfigurationBuilder(); } public static final class PCKS11ConfigurationBuilder { private String name; private String library; private String description; private int slotId; private int slotListIndex; private PCKS11ConfigurationBuilder() { slotId = -1; slotListIndex = 0; } public PCKS11ConfigurationBuilder setName(String name) { if (name == null || name.isEmpty()) { throw new IllegalArgumentException("Parameter name must not be null or empty."); } this.name = name; return this; } public PCKS11ConfigurationBuilder setLibrary(String library) { if (library == null || library.isEmpty()) { throw new IllegalArgumentException("Parameter library must not be null or empty."); } this.library = library; return this; } public PCKS11ConfigurationBuilder setDescription(String description) { this.description = description; return this; } public PCKS11ConfigurationBuilder setSlotListIndex(int slotListIndex) { if (slotListIndex < 0) { throw new IllegalArgumentException( "Parameter slotListIndex must be greater or equal to zero."); } this.slotListIndex = slotListIndex; this.slotId = -1; return this; } public final PCKS11ConfigurationBuilder setSlotId(int slotId) { if (slotId < 0) { throw new IllegalArgumentException( "Parameter slotId must be greater or equal to zero."); } this.slotId = slotId; this.slotListIndex = -1; return this; } public PKCS11Configuration build() { validateBuilderState(); return new PKCS11Configuration(name, library, description, slotId, slotListIndex); } private void validateBuilderState() { if (name == null) { throw new IllegalStateException("A name must be set."); } if (library == null) { throw new IllegalStateException("A library must be set."); } } } }
